2. cocoindex — cocoindex-io/cocoindex

  • Repo: https://github.com/cocoindex-io/cocoindex
  • Self-description: "Incremental engine for long horizon agents."
  • Language: Rust (Python bindings)
  • Topics: context-engineering, indexing, rag, data-indexing, change-data-capture, knowledge-graph, semantic-search, long-horizon-agent, agentic-data-framework
  • Boundary flag: likely a Context-engine / Execution-substrate subsystem (incremental indexing, CDC, RAG pipeline) rather than a full scheduler-bearing runtime — it feeds context in, it doesn't run the loop. Good test of the grain/boundary decision: does a runtime subsystem get its own review, slot into a runtime review, or sit closer to the existing memory corpus? Contrast with flue, which is execution-substrate + scheduler.
